Sarah Perez

Sarah Perez practices real estate law with a focus on assisting nonprofit, for-profit, and public entities to finance and develop affordable family housing and community facilities. Sarah represents clients through all stages of the real estate development process, including site acquisition, due diligence and project financing. She works with clients utilizing Low Income Housing Tax Credits; New Markets Tax Credits; Tax-Exempt Bonds; and local, state and federal funding sources.

Prior to practicing law, Sarah served as a project manager for the Los Angeles County Community Development Commission administering HUD-funded HOME loans and local tax-increment set-aside investments in affordable housing developments. Sarah also worked in the nonprofit sector as a housing advocate and development director for a homeless services organization. In her free time, Sarah is busy exploring the Pacific Northwest.
